Laser Scanning & Twinmotion Renderings — Peoria Players Theatre, Peoria IL

Peoria Players Theatre needed to expand its restroom capacity to meet growing audience demands. Before architects could finalize designs for the addition, the project team needed a clear visual representation of how the new facility would integrate with the existing building.

TWG deployed the Leica RTC360 to capture comprehensive scan data of Peoria Players Theatre’s interior and exterior. From that scan data, TWG produced a Revit model of the existing building and the proposed restroom addition within the same environment. Finally, TWG created a Twinmotion rendering of both the existing structure and the new addition— delivering photorealistic visualizations that gave stakeholders and decision-makers a clear vision of the finished project before design approval.

The Challenge: Visualizing An Addition Before Design Approval

Theatre renovation projects demand clear communication between designers and decision-makers. When Peoria Players Theatre planned to add new restroom facilities, the design team faced a critical challenge: how could stakeholders and leadership evaluate the addition’s impact on the existing building before committing to design approval?

Traditional 2D drawings often fail to convey spatial relationships and visual impact to non-technical stakeholders. Moreover, renderings created from incomplete design data risk miscommunication and costly changes during construction planning.

Peoria Players Theatre needed a photorealistic visualization of both the existing building and the proposed addition that stakeholders could understand immediately and evaluate confidently.

Our Solution: Laser Scanning To Photorealistic Renderings

TWG deployed the Leica RTC360 throughout Peoria Players Theatre — capturing high-density point cloud data of the interior and exterior in a single coordinated scan. The scanner documented every surface and spatial relationship with precision. Walls, openings, and the building envelope were all captured in three dimensions without disruption to theatre operations.

From that point cloud data, TWG’s team built a Revit model of the existing building. The model captured the theatre’s actual geometry accurately.

Next, TWG modeled the proposed restroom addition within the same Revit environment. By placing the new design within the scanned building model, architects could evaluate spatial relationships and design coordination. In addition, this approach allowed designers to assess how the addition would integrate with the existing structure.

Finally, TWG rendered both the existing theatre and the restroom addition in Twinmotion. These photorealistic renderings showed stakeholders exactly how the completed project would look from multiple viewpoints. As a result, theatre leadership could evaluate the addition’s visual impact and spatial integration without requiring technical expertise to interpret architectural drawings.

The Result: Confident Design Approval And Stakeholder Engagement

The Revit model gave the design team a precise digital representation of the building. Consequently, architects could evaluate spatial relationships and ensure the addition coordinated properly with the existing structure.

The Twinmotion renderings transformed the approval process. Theatre leadership could see the restroom addition integrated into the existing building in photorealistic detail from multiple angles. Moreover, stakeholders could evaluate the design’s visual impact and spatial integration without requiring architectural expertise to interpret 2D drawings.

By starting from laser scan data captured directly from the building, rather than relying on field measurements, the team eliminated guesswork in the addition design. The renderings provided the clarity stakeholders needed to approve the design confidently before moving to construction documentation.
